The Formula

The underlying logic of the ROI calculation is based on a straightforward formula: ROI = (Net Benefits / Total Costs) x 100. In this context, Net Benefits are calculated by subtracting the total costs of the training from the financial gains attributed to the training outcomes, such as reduced compliance violations, lower fines, or improved productivity. By using this formula, the calculator captures the true financial impact of your compliance training, enabling you to see not just the costs involved but also the potential savings and revenue increases that can result from effective training.

💡 Industry Pro Tip

One of the most common pitfalls in evaluating ROI is overlooking indirect benefits. While it's essential to account for direct cost savings, consider also how improved compliance training can enhance employee morale, reduce turnover, and improve your organization's reputation. These factors can indirectly contribute to financial gains that may not be immediately quantifiable but are critical to long-term success. Always aim to capture both direct and indirect benefits when assessing the ROI of your compliance training programs for a more comprehensive understanding of their value.

FAQ

Q: What types of costs should I include in the total cost of training? A: Include all relevant expenses such as training materials, instructor fees, employee time spent in training, and any technology costs associated with delivering the training.

Q: How do I measure the financial impact of compliance training? A: Look for quantifiable metrics such as reductions in compliance violations, savings from avoided fines, and any improvements in productivity that can be attributed to better compliance practices.

Q: Can I use this calculator for different types of training beyond compliance? A: While designed for compliance training, the principles of ROI calculation can be applied to other training programs as well, with adjustments to the inputs and metrics considered.
